Understanding Mosquito Netting Types

According to Dr. Emily Hargrove, an entomologist specializing in insect resistance, “The type of netting you choose largely depends on your intended use.” Here are the main varieties:

  • Insect-Resistant Cloth: This is ideal for camping and outdoor activities. Made from tightly woven polyester or nylon, it not only blocks insects but is also durable.
  • Screen Mesh: Perfect for ventilated areas at home, allowing air circulation while keeping mosquitoes out.
  • Bed Nets: Essential for those in high-risk zones. These usually come treated with insect repellent for added protection.

Key Features to Consider

Expert advice from Mark Linton, a home improvement specialist, emphasizes looking for certain features before purchasing mosquito netting:

Material Quality

"Choose high-quality, UV-resistant fabrics to ensure longevity," Linton recommends. Quality netting resists wear and tear, making it a cost-effective option in the long run.

Mesh Density

“The tighter the weave, the better the protection,” explains Lara Jensen, a product designer. She advises looking for netting with a mesh density of at least 1.2 mm to effectively keep mosquitoes at bay while maintaining airflow.

Best Practices for Installation

The installation of mosquito netting can significantly affect its effectiveness. Tom Reilly, a camping gear expert, notes, “Proper installation is as crucial as the quality of the netting.” Here are some tips:

  • Secure Fit: Ensure the netting fits snugly around frames or openings to prevent gaps.
  • Use Weights: Adding weights at the bottom can help keep the netting in place on windy days.
  • Treat with Insect Repellent: For added protection, consider treating your netting with a safe insect repellent.

Importance of Maintenance

Dr. Sarah McCoy, a pest control expert, emphasizes the need for regular maintenance. “Check your mosquito netting periodically for tears or damages. A small hole can compromise your protection,” she advises.
